Minister announces Families First Pioneers, 20/07/10 [W]

Deputy Minister for Children Huw Lewis has announced Wales’ first "Families First Pioneer areas".

The first Pioneer areas will be led by Wrexham working with Flintshire and Denbighshire, and Rhondda Cynon Taf working with Merthyr Tydfil and Blaenau Gwent.

The aim of the Pioneers is to lead the way in improving the delivery of services to families across Wales, especially those living in poverty, as set out in the Assembly Government’s draft Child Poverty Strategy.
